![]() The United Nations General Assembly on Thursday approved former Iraqi President Barham Salih as the next head of the UN refugee agency, its first from the Middle East since the late 1970s. He became Iraq’s president in 2018 and served until 2022. Salih succeeds longtime agency veteran Filippo Grandi, whose second five-year term expires Dec. 31. Salih's five-year term starts Jan. 1. |
